How do you know if my US visa is approved?

  1. Overview. If your visa application is approved, your passport and visa will be available for pick up at the U.S. Embassy.
  2. Check the Status of Your Visa. You can check the status of your application any time at this website: https://ceac.state.gov/CEACStatTracker/Status.aspx.

How do I track my I-130 application?

Applying within the United States

  1. Find your “Receipt Number.” (See “Receipt Numbers” below.)
  2. Visit USCIS’ “Case Status Online” tracker.
  3. Enter your Receipt Number.
  4. Click “Check Status.”

What happens after I-130 is approved for siblings?

Answer: After USCIS approved the sibling (brother or sister) immigrant visa petition of Form I-130, the U.S. citizen’s brother or sister will receive a “priority date,” based on the day USCIS first received the Form I-130 petition. Why is US visa rejected?

Insufficient or Incorrect Information. Providing incorrect or missing information in the application form will result into a US visa rejection. So, ensure that the information you fill matches the documentary proof, such as address, passport number, date of birth, employment details etc.

How long do us visa interviews take?

You can expect to be at the Embassy or Consulate for approximately two to three hours. The interview with a consular officer is the last step in a two-step process and typically lasts just a few minutes. Prior to the interview staff will collect, data-enter and review your application.

How do I know if my I-130 is approved?

You can check your I-130 petition’s status, and if you notice that your online case status is “approved,” but you still haven’t received your NOA2, you can contact USCIS at 1-800-375-5283.

Can an issued visa be Cancelled?

A U.S. visa can be or revoked or cancelled for a myriad of reasons. Visas may be revoked by a U.S. Department of State (DOS) consular officer at a U.S. Embassy or U.S. Consulate. The most common grounds for visa revocation or cancellation include: Visa was fraudulently-issued or was used in a fraudulent manner.

What is your relationship to this relative I-130?

Form I-130 is one of the most important ones in an immigrating spouse’s immigration process. The “petitioner” is the U.S. citizen spouse, who is filing this petition on the would-be immigrant’s behalf. The immigrant is referred to as “your relative” or the “beneficiary.”

How long does it take to get a US visa after interview?

Some visa applications require further administrative processing, which takes additional time after the visa applicant’s interview by a Consular Officer. Applicants are advised of this requirement when they apply. Most administrative processing is resolved within 60 days of the visa interview.

How long can a relative stay in the US with a visa?

However, the visa does not govern the length of his or her authorized stay in the U.S. — it merely allows your relative to enter the United States during that time period. Instead, your relative’s Form I-94 governs his or her authorized stay in the United States.

When do I get my green card after immigrating to USA?

If you have paid the USCIS Immigrant Fee, you will receive your Green Card in the mail after you arrive in the United States. If you do not receive your Green Card within 45 days of your arrival, please call our USCIS Contact Center at 800-375-5283.
